Day 47 – A Year of Gratitude and Joy – Warmth (Guest Blog)

The high temperature forecast for this weekend is in the 80s. The pool is now covered, starting to soak in the sun. I turned off the camera and took a meeting from the pool deck, relishing the ultraviolet rays as they infused vitamin D in my body.

It’s February in Arizona, and I’m grateful for warmth!

A February heat wave lets us get our base tan started.

My Facebook feed is littered with the detritus of a snow and ice-covered nation to the east … National Weather Service forecasts for the Washington, D.C. area showing overnight lows in the 20s everywhere you look … a funny video of a guy in a bathrobe using a flamethrower to clear his driveway. I did a television interview for work with one of the TV personalities bundled-up for his live shots outside … in Dallas!

A live news shot shows how cold it is in Dallas.

When Judy and I lived in northern Virginia, we often spent cold winter nights covered in blankets by the fireplace, sipping hot chocolate laced with something alcoholic, staying warm and happy that we weren’t outside. These days, the fireplace is unnecessary and the “something alcoholic” usually tinkles with ice.

Even at Christmas there was no need for hot beverages.

There’s a whole world out there, waiting to be explored. Cold and snowy has its own beauty, but sometimes you just need to go where it’s warm!
